In my childhood, the only good cameras were held by those with more money than us and family gathering photos are not readily available for taking that trip down memory lane. So, whenever I get any portion of my kids together, I get a family photo with them. To be honest, it is probably more for me than anyone else, but I am the picture bully, and I am okay with that. One day, the littles wont be little anymore and they will see that we were a family of love. They will know the challenges of our existence, but they will know that we did have love.
So, what is a family? Some say blood. Some say relationship. I say, a family is a host of people brought together by God’s grace. Some in that gathering will be blood, others not, but still family. You will not get along with all the members or even agree with all of them, but you will still have that underlying love. I have many people that I consider family. Once your soul pierces my heart, you are family. You are welcome in my home. I will help in any way that I can, and I will include you in my family photos. Once you make the photo, you are in.
God told us to go out and make disciples. To build the Kingdom. How can we do that if we are not willing to build our family? Your family will look different than mine. That’s fine. Your family will have different characters. That’s fine. We are not meant to be cookie cutter families, all the same, but take a risk, take a chance, build your family. One soul at a time.
Yesterday I invited (bullied) my daughter-in-law’s mom to join us in our photo. She said that she was not the family. I told our son to let her know that she IS family. Forever. She is stuck with me. She joined us.
Build your family … not by the world’s standards … but by God’s.
